JetBlue Airways Yields from JFK, LGA and EWR MGMT 642 M7-Written Assignment 4 Alois Nyandoro Embry Riddle Aeronautical University

Abstract
This mini research analyzed fares for JetBlue Airways flights from New York metropolitan airports [New York Kennedy (JFK), Newark (EWR) and LaGuardia(LGA)] to four selected destinations; Orlando (MCO), Fort Lauderdale (FLL), Austin (AUS) and San Francisco (SFO). The objective was to establish if JetBlue enjoys higher yields for flights from JFK than LGA or EWR. The result was that fares for flights from JFK and LGA are similar and consistently lower than flights from EWR. The reason could be that JFK is JetBlue Airways hub and by proximity LGA could be considered to have similar hub factors. This research explored the hub effect on fares. However, other factors should be explored and analyzed to establish and pin down the specific reasons behind the fare differences between the NY metropolitan airports.
Introduction
JetBlue is a low cost carrier with its headquarters in Long Island City. It uses JFK as its hub and operates to 75 destinations in multiple cities. It is the largest airline in the Northeast of United States. It flies to different destinations out of the three major airports (JFK, EWR and LGA) serving New York/New Jersey metropolitan area. Given the relative proximity of these airports, one would assume that JetBlue has similar fares to same destinations. After deregulation of 1978, airline pricing increasingly became complicated as opposed to the CAB pricing system based on cost per available seat mile. Factors affecting airline pricing strategies can be grouped into five factors; costs, demand, supply, competition and rates and taxes. Therefore any factors affecting this group of factors can potentially affect the fares of a particular flight or the pricing in a specific market.

...Michael D. Smith W e present a framework and empirical estimates that quantify the economic impact of increased product variety made available through electronic markets. While efficiency gains from increased competition significantly enhance consumer surplus, for instance, by leading to lower average selling prices, our present research shows that increased product variety made available through electronic markets can be a significantly larger source of consumer surplus gains. One reason for increased product variety on the Internet is the ability of online retailers to catalog, recommend, and provide a large number of products for sale. For example, the number of book titles available at Amazon.com is more than 23 times larger than the number of books on the shelves of a typical Barnes & Noble superstore, and 57 times greater than the number of books stocked in a typical large independent bookstore. Our analysis indicates that the increased product variety of online bookstores enhanced consumer welfare by $731 million to $1.03 billion in the year 2000, which is between 7 and 10 times as large as the consumer welfare gain from increased competition and lower prices in this market. There may also be large welfare gains in other SKU-intensive consumer goods such as music, movies, consumer electronics, and computer software and hardware. (Consumer Surplus; Product Variety;...
